Frequently Asked Questions
What is the population of ZIP code 12832?
ZIP code 12832 (New York) has a population of 6,486 (2022 Census data).
What is the median household income in 12832?
The median household income in ZIP code 12832 is $64,256 per year.
How much is rent in ZIP code 12832?
The median monthly rent in 12832 is $763.
What is the median home value in 12832?
The median home value in ZIP code 12832 is $145,100.
What is the poverty rate in 12832?
The poverty rate in ZIP code 12832 is 10.9%.
